MOORHEAD, Minn. — The tenth-ranked Moorhead Spuds scored four unanswered goals to down Rogers 4-1 on Saturday night at the Moorhead Sports Center. Senior Carter Randklev lead the way with a goal and an assist. The goal was Randklev’s 65th of his career. Captain Cole O’Connell notched two goals as well for the Spuds. Men’s Basketball: Miller Leads Bison Past Western Illinois

NDSU improves to 4-3 in the Summit League

FARGO, N.D. (NDSU Athletics) – North Dakota State senior Paul Miller poured in 26 points to lead the Bison men’s basketball team to an 80-69 win over Western Illinois on Saturday afternoon at the Scheels Center. Men’s Hockey: UND Ties Denver for Second Straight Night

DU gets the extra point in overtime.

GRAND FORKS, N.D. — The 11th-ranked UND Fighting Hawks tied fourth-ranked Denver on Saturday night for the second straight time. Just like Friday night, the Pioneers scored in the overtime frame to gain the extra point. The Fighting Hawks host Colorado College next weekend at the Ralph Engelstad Arena. MSUM Women’s Basketball Extends Win Streak to 10

The Dragons beat down Southwest Minnesota State 66-51

MOORHEAD, Minn. — MSUM women’s basketball is tearing through NSIC play this season. The Dragons have rattled off 10 wins in a row since losing to Northern State on December 15th.
